Gemini Community Support Site

This Gemini community support site can be used to find solutions to product issues. You can log in using Open Id, Google Profile and even Facebook. Feel free to ask a question or browse FAQs and documentation. Product tour videos are also available along with how-to videos demonstrating key Gemini capabilities.




Failed to import Mantis database to Gemini

migration

The following error ocurred when I tryed to import a Mantis MySQL database to Gemini:

00000075 518.59051514 [5736]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Exception occurs on Issue creation. Referência de objeto não definida para uma instância de um objeto. :: CounterSoft.Gemini.DataImport.BLL :: em CounterSoft.Gemini.DataImport.BLL.Mantis.MySQL.MNTIssuesExporter_v114.Prepare(Object key)
00000076 518.59051514 [5736] em CounterSoft.Gemini.DataImport.Mapping.ExistingIssuesImporter.ImportIssues(Hashtable& ProjectLUT, Hashtable& versionLUT, Hashtable& componentLUT, Hashtable& customFieldLUT)

The portuguese exception message (Referência de objeto não definida para uma instância de um objeto.) comes from the localization of the .NET Framework and the meaning is the same as "null reference".

Could someone help me?

ricmmx
· 1
ricmmx
Replies (6)
helpful
0
not helpful

Please send your sample source file to support at countersoft dot com.


Bikram
· 1
Bikram
helpful
0
not helpful

Unfortunetely my database contains sensitive information, so I cannot send it to you.

But I could see that the import tool is trying to access MySQL database with a SQLServer connection object (some "Mantis114" object) causing a null reference exception.


ricmmx
· 1
ricmmx
helpful
0
not helpful

Please provide us the DebugView output. http://technet.microsoft.com/en-us/sysinternals/bb896647.aspx

Email the output file to support at countersoft dot com


Bikram
· 1
Bikram
helpful
0
not helpful

LOG:

Gemini Data Import Log v1.1.0 Build 2374 10/08/2009 09:11:30

** Import Status **

Custom Field(s)

Source project: CMA Series 4 - v1.4 --> Destination project: CMA Series 4 - v1.4

Origem do Defeito: Success

Source project: CME Sinal Fix - 657 --> Destination project: CME Sinal Fix - 657

Source project: Contribuidor de Notícias - 775 --> Destination project: Contribuidor de Notícias - 775

Source project: AlgoServer --> Destination project: AlgoServer

Source project: Grafico Web --> Destination project: Grafico Web

Source project: Portfólio Serfiex --> Destination project: Portfólio Serfiex

Source project: CMA Algoritmos --> Destination project: CMA Algoritmos

Source project: Template --> Destination project: Template

Issue(s)

Source project: CMA Series 4 - v1.4 --> Destination project: CMA Series 4 - v1.4 : 0 Issues imported

Final Status

Success: 1 Project(s) mapped and 0 issue(s) imported successfully

Source project: CMA Series 4 - v1.4 --> Destination project: CMA Series 4 - v1.4

Failure: 7 Project(s) mapped and 7 issue(s) not imported

Source project: CME Sinal Fix - 657 --> Destination project: CME Sinal Fix - 657 Source project: Contribuidor de Notícias - 775 --> Destination project: Contribuidor de Notícias - 775 Source project: AlgoServer --> Destination project: AlgoServer Source project: Grafico Web --> Destination project: Grafico Web Source project: Portfólio Serfiex --> Destination project: Portfólio Serfiex Source project: CMA Algoritmos --> Destination project: CMA Algoritmos Source project: Template --> Destination project: Template

Troubleshooting:'Transaction Failed'

1) Ensure your source data conforms to the guidelines specified in the Gemini Data Import User Guide (All Programs > Countersoft > Gemini Data Import > Gemini User Guide)

2) While importing from CSV and Excel, ensure source date format is set as per format specified in Sample CSV and Excel files.

3) To trace failure reason, run DebugView from All Programs > Countersoft > Gemini Data Import > DebugView or http://technet.microsoft.com/en-us/sysinternals/bb896647.aspx and retry to import the failed project. DebugView will most likely trap the fail error(s). Send DebugView output to support@countersoft.com.

4) If you are importing from CSV, Excel Fixed Format or Excel Flat Format, you can email your sample source data to us at support@countersoft.com. We will review and provide feedback.

DEBUG:

[2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Started [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Start DoLogin [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Checking Model.Authenticated [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Starting logon process [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Calling ServiceHelper.AuthorisationServicesLogIn [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: DoLogin End [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Start Page Loading [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: End Page Loading [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Start Main Tab Functionality [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: End Main Tab Functionality [2724] In DLLCanUnloadNow [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Start Connecting to server and fetch project [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: End fetching [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Start Importing [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: fetching Custom Field(s) of Project CMA Series 4 - v1.4 [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: prepare Custom Field [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: get all Custom Field defs [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Check exist Custom Field [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Cheking end [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Set number of rows [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Mapping with project of custom field [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: mapping done [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Go to next custom fields [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: fetching Custom Field(s) of Project CME Sinal Fix - 657 [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: prepare Custom Field [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: fetching Custom Field(s) of Project Contribuidor de Notícias - 775 [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: prepare Custom Field [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: fetching Custom Field(s) of Project AlgoServer [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: prepare Custom Field [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: fetching Custom Field(s) of Project Grafico Web [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: prepare Custom Field [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: fetching Custom Field(s) of Project Portfólio Serfiex [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: prepare Custom Field [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: fetching Custom Field(s) of Project CMA Algoritmos [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: prepare Custom Field [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: fetching Custom Field(s) of Project Template [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: prepare Custom Field [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: fetching Issue(s) of Soucre Project CMA Series 4 - v1.4 --> Destination project CMA Series 4 - v1.4 [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: prepare Issue(s) [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: fetching Issue from source [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: fetching Issue(s) of Soucre Project CME Sinal Fix - 657 --> Destination project CME Sinal Fix - 657 [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: prepare Issue(s) [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Exception occurs on Issue creation. Referência de objeto não definida para uma instância de um objeto. :: CounterSoft.Gemini.DataImport.BLL :: em CounterSoft.Gemini.DataImport.BLL.Mantis.MySQL.MNTIssuesExporterv114.Prepare(Object key) [2264] em CounterSoft.Gemini.DataImport.Mapping.ExistingIssuesImporter.ImportIssues(Hashtable& ProjectLUT, Hashtable& versionLUT, Hashtable& componentLUT, Hashtable& customFieldLUT) [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Issues Rollbacked from CME Sinal Fix - 657 existing Project [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: fetching Issue(s) of Soucre Project Contribuidor de Notícias - 775 --> Destination project Contribuidor de Notícias - 775 [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: prepare Issue(s) [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Exception occurs on Issue creation. Referência de objeto não definida para uma instância de um objeto. :: CounterSoft.Gemini.DataImport.BLL :: em CounterSoft.Gemini.DataImport.BLL.Mantis.MySQL.MNTIssuesExporterv114.Prepare(Object key) [2264] em CounterSoft.Gemini.DataImport.Mapping.ExistingIssuesImporter.ImportIssues(Hashtable& ProjectLUT, Hashtable& versionLUT, Hashtable& componentLUT, Hashtable& customFieldLUT) [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Issues Rollbacked from Contribuidor de Notícias - 775 existing Project [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: fetching Issue(s) of Soucre Project AlgoServer --> Destination project AlgoServer [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: prepare Issue(s) [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Exception occurs on Issue creation. Referência de objeto não definida para uma instância de um objeto. :: CounterSoft.Gemini.DataImport.BLL :: em CounterSoft.Gemini.DataImport.BLL.Mantis.MySQL.MNTIssuesExporterv114.Prepare(Object key) [2264] em CounterSoft.Gemini.DataImport.Mapping.ExistingIssuesImporter.ImportIssues(Hashtable& ProjectLUT, Hashtable& versionLUT, Hashtable& componentLUT, Hashtable& customFieldLUT) [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Issues Rollbacked from AlgoServer existing Project [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: fetching Issue(s) of Soucre Project Grafico Web --> Destination project Grafico Web [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: prepare Issue(s) [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Exception occurs on Issue creation. Referência de objeto não definida para uma instância de um objeto. :: CounterSoft.Gemini.DataImport.BLL :: em CounterSoft.Gemini.DataImport.BLL.Mantis.MySQL.MNTIssuesExporterv114.Prepare(Object key) [2264] em CounterSoft.Gemini.DataImport.Mapping.ExistingIssuesImporter.ImportIssues(Hashtable& ProjectLUT, Hashtable& versionLUT, Hashtable& componentLUT, Hashtable& customFieldLUT) [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Issues Rollbacked from Grafico Web existing Project [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: fetching Issue(s) of Soucre Project Portfólio Serfiex --> Destination project Portfólio Serfiex [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: prepare Issue(s) [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Exception occurs on Issue creation. Referência de objeto não definida para uma instância de um objeto. :: CounterSoft.Gemini.DataImport.BLL :: em CounterSoft.Gemini.DataImport.BLL.Mantis.MySQL.MNTIssuesExporterv114.Prepare(Object key) [2264] em CounterSoft.Gemini.DataImport.Mapping.ExistingIssuesImporter.ImportIssues(Hashtable& ProjectLUT, Hashtable& versionLUT, Hashtable& componentLUT, Hashtable& customFieldLUT) [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Issues Rollbacked from Portfólio Serfiex existing Project [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: fetching Issue(s) of Soucre Project CMA Algoritmos --> Destination project CMA Algoritmos [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: prepare Issue(s) [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Exception occurs on Issue creation. Referência de objeto não definida para uma instância de um objeto. :: CounterSoft.Gemini.DataImport.BLL :: em CounterSoft.Gemini.DataImport.BLL.Mantis.MySQL.MNTIssuesExporterv114.Prepare(Object key) [2264] em CounterSoft.Gemini.DataImport.Mapping.ExistingIssuesImporter.ImportIssues(Hashtable& ProjectLUT, Hashtable& versionLUT, Hashtable& componentLUT, Hashtable& customFieldLUT) [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Issues Rollbacked from CMA Algoritmos existing Project [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: fetching Issue(s) of Soucre Project Template --> Destination project Template [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: prepare Issue(s) [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Exception occurs on Issue creation. Referência de objeto não definida para uma instância de um objeto. :: CounterSoft.Gemini.DataImport.BLL :: em CounterSoft.Gemini.DataImport.BLL.Mantis.MySQL.MNTIssuesExporter_v114.Prepare(Object key) [2264] em CounterSoft.Gemini.DataImport.Mapping.ExistingIssuesImporter.ImportIssues(Hashtable& ProjectLUT, Hashtable& versionLUT, Hashtable& componentLUT, Hashtable& customFieldLUT) [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Issues Rollbacked from Template existing Project [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Start update Sub Issues [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: End update Sub Issues [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Start update Issues Links [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: End update Issues Links [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Start update comments with IssueLink qualifier [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: End update comments with IssueLink qualifier [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Start update Descriptions with IssueLink qualifier [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: End update Descriptions with IssueLink qualifier [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: Transaction failed! Contact your Gemini Administrator. [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: 1 Project(s) mapped, 0 issue(s) imported successfully. [2264] 7 Project(s) mapped, 7 issue(s) not imported due to bad data [2264] CounterSoft.Gemini.DataImport 1.1.0 Build 2374: End Importing


ricmmx
· 1
ricmmx
helpful
0
not helpful

Hello. Unfortunately we were unable to positively identify the issue thus far. We need some sample data to troubleshoot further. Is is possible for you to provide a sample data file with just a handful of issues?


Bikram
· 1
Bikram
helpful
0
not helpful

We giving up to use Gemini for now. Thanks


ricmmx
· 1
ricmmx